小结
• 全视角光学膜可以有效改善LCD视角色差现象.
• 有别于传统相位补偿技术, 全视角光学薄膜可外贴
于LCD改善视角特性.
• 全视角光学膜的补偿原理具有广泛适用性, 使其亦
可用于非LCD, 例如OLED, 视角色差改善.
• 整合全视角光学膜光学补偿特性与 LCD整体设计,有
提升整体效能, 品质与成本竞争力的潜力.
